Table 2.

Microbiology and route of infection in 22 patients with septic arthritis.

CharacteristicsPatients with Septic Arthritis, n = 22
Microbiology
  Streptococcus spp.15 (23)
  S. aureus5 (23)
  Anaerobes23 (14)
  Escherichia coli1 (5)
  Other pathogens32 (9)
  Culture negative8 (36)
Route of infection
  Hematogenous14 (64)
  Postinterventional6 (27)
  Posttraumatic1 (5)
  Contiguous from adjacent focus1 (5)
Pretreated with antimicrobials7 (32)
  • Data are n (%) of patients. Percentages are rounded and may not add up to 100.

  • 1 S. agalactiae (n = 2), S. dysgalactiae (n = 2), S. pneumoniae (n = 1).

  • 2 Clostridium clostridioforme (n = 1), Cutibacterium acnes (n = 1), Finegoldia magna (n = 1).

  • 3 Two patients had mixed infection, including Staphylococcus aureus and Corynebacterium striatum in 1 patient and Finegoldia magna and Staphylococcus epidermidis in another.
